Algert Global LLC lessened its position in Stride, Inc. (NYSE:LRN - Free Report) by 12.8% during the 1st qu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 67,484 shares of the company's stock after selling 9,941 shares during the period. Algert Global LLC owned about 0.16% of Stride worth $8,537,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C.

Insiders Place Their Bets
In related news, CEO James Jeaho Rhyu sold 13,961 shares of Stride stock in a transaction that occurred on Tuesday, August 19th. The shares were sold at an average price of $162.66, for a total transaction of $2,270,896.26. Following the transaction, the chief executive officer owned 706,353 shares of the company's stock, valued at $114,895,378.98. This trade represents a 1.94% decrease in their position. Stride (NYSE:LRN -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, August 5th. The company reported $2.29 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.83 by $0.46. Stride had a net margin of 11.97% and a return on equity of 25.51%. The business had revenue of $653.65 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$626.23 million. During the same quarter last year, the firm earned $1.42 EPS. Stride's quarterly revenue was up 22.4% compared to the same quarter last year. Equities research analysts anticipate that Stride, Inc. will post 6.67 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Stride, Inc, a technology-based education service company, engages in the provision of proprietary and third-party online curriculum, software systems, and educational services in the United States and internationally. Its technology-based products and services enable clients to attract, enroll, educate, track progress, support, and facilitate individualized learning for students.
